source: FOIAVistA/tag/r/NOIS-FSC/FSCFORMB.m@ 628

Last change on this file since 628 was 628, checked in by George Lilly, 14 years ago

initial load of FOIAVistA 6/30/08 version

File size: 1.8 KB
Line 
1FSCFORMB ;SLC/STAFF-NOIS Format Brief ;10/20/97 16:15
2 ;;1.1;NOIS;;Sep 06, 1998
3 ;
4BRIEF ; from FSCFORM
5 N CNT,NUM,TEXT K TEXT
6 F FIELD="MOD","SITE","SPEC","EDITD","RECD","DEVSTAT","STATUS","PRI","IRM","PHONE" S FIELD(FIELD)=""
7 D GET^FSCGET("CUSTOM",CALLNUM,.FIELD)
8 D TEXT^FSCFORMT(CALLNUM,.TEXT,7)
9 ; setsup FORMAT array from FIELD array, call number, and starting line number into array
10 N FORMAT K FORMAT
11 D SETTEXT^FSCFORM(1,1,2," Module: "_$P($G(FIELD("MOD")),U,2))
12 D SETTEXT^FSCFORM(1,2,2," Location: "_$P($G(FIELD("SITE")),U,2))
13 D SETTEXT^FSCFORM(1,3,2," Contact: "_$P($G(FIELD("IRM")),U,2))
14 D SETTEXT^FSCFORM(1,4,2," Phone: "_$P($G(FIELD("PHONE")),U,2))
15 D SETTEXT^FSCFORM(1,5,2," Specialist: "_$P($G(FIELD("SPEC")),U,2))
16 D SETTEXT^FSCFORM(1,1,47," Status: "_$P($G(FIELD("STATUS")),U,2))
17 D SETTEXT^FSCFORM(1,2,47,"Status (Ref): "_$P($G(FIELD("DEVSTAT")),U,2))
18 D SETTEXT^FSCFORM(1,3,47," Priority: "_$P($G(FIELD("PRI")),U,2))
19 D SETTEXT^FSCFORM(1,4,47,"First Edited: "_$P($P($G(FIELD("RECD")),U,2),":",1,2))
20 D SETTEXT^FSCFORM(1,5,47," Last Edited: "_$P($P($G(FIELD("EDITD")),U,2),":",1,2))
21 D SETTEXT^FSCFORM(1,6,1," Description: ",RVON,RVOFF)
22 D SETTEXT^FSCFORM(1,6,20,TEXT("D"))
23 S CNT=6,NUM=0 F S NUM=$O(TEXT("D",NUM)) Q:NUM<1 S CNT=CNT+1 D SETTEXT^FSCFORM(1,CNT,1,TEXT("D",NUM))
24 D SETTEXT^FSCFORM(2,1,1," Notes: ",RVON,RVOFF)
25 D SETTEXT^FSCFORM(2,1,20,TEXT("N"))
26 S CNT=1,NUM=0 F S NUM=$O(TEXT("N",NUM)) Q:NUM<1 S CNT=CNT+1 D SETTEXT^FSCFORM(2,CNT,1,TEXT("N",NUM))
27 D SETTEXT^FSCFORM(3,1,1," Resolution: ",RVON,RVOFF)
28 D SETTEXT^FSCFORM(3,1,20,TEXT("R"))
29 S CNT=1,NUM=0 F S NUM=$O(TEXT("R",NUM)) Q:NUM<1 S CNT=CNT+1 D SETTEXT^FSCFORM(3,CNT,1,TEXT("R",NUM))
30 I TYPE["VIEW" D VIEW^FSCFORMU(LISTNUM,CALLNUM,.FORMAT,STYLE,.LASTLINE,TYPE) Q
31 D SETUP^FSCFORMU(LISTNUM,CALLNUM,.FORMAT,STYLE,.LASTLINE,TYPE)
32 Q
Note: See TracBrowser for help on using the repository browser.